New styles just dropped: explore now
New arrivals
Mens fashion
Only&Sons Junior
Shop for her
Offers
Home
Mens fashion
Shorts
Sort after:
Name
Price (low to high)
Price (high to low)
New Arrivals
Recommended
Highest discount
No elements found. Consider changing the search query.
List is empty.
Sort after:
Name
Price (low to high)
Price (high to low)
New Arrivals
Recommended
Highest discount
No elements found. Consider changing the search query.
List is empty.
Colour
Select option
Grey
51
Blue
45
Black
31
Green
14
White
9
Olive
4
Orange
3
Rose
3
Purple
2
Turquoise
1
Yellow
1
No elements found. Consider changing the search query.
List is empty.
Clear
Select
Size
Select option
XXS
2
XS
109
s
52
S
108
m
43
M
109
l
41
L
107
XL
150
XXL
145
XXXL
2
No elements found. Consider changing the search query.
List is empty.
Clear
Select
Discount
Select option
40%
2
30%
4
20%
1
No elements found. Consider changing the search query.
List is empty.
Clear
Select
Amount
Select option
No elements found. Consider changing the search query.
List is empty.
16 £
45 £
Price selection must be between £16.00 and £45.00
Clear
Select
ONSTEL Regular Fit Shorts
£28.00
ONSPLY Mid waist Regular Fit Shorts
£36.00
ONSKIAN Mid waist Regular Fit Shorts
£28.00
ONSPETER Regular Fit Shorts
£30.00
ONSTREV Mid waist Regular Fit Shorts
£30.00
ONSCARL Mid rise Balloon Fit Shorts
£30.00
ONSTEL Mid waist Regular Fit Shorts
£30.00
ONSKYLE Regular rise Regular Fit Shorts
£32.00
BESTSELLER
ONSMARK Mid waist Regular Fit Shorts
£30.00
ONSPLY Mid waist Slim Fit Shorts
£38.00
ONSPLY Regular rise Regular Fit Shorts
£30.00
ONSCARL Mid rise Balloon Fit Shorts
£30.00
ONSTED Swim Shorts
£18.00
ONSTEL Regular Fit Shorts
£32.00
ONSPETER Regular Fit Shorts
£36.00
ONSPLY Mid waist Regular Fit Shorts
£36.00
ONSPLY Mid waist Slim Fit Shorts
£28.00
ONSKIAN Mid waist Regular Fit Shorts
£28.00
ONSMARK Regular Fit Shorts
£36.00
ONSEDGE Mid waist Straight Fit Shorts
£30.00
ONSPETER Regular Fit Shorts
£36.00
ONSEDGE Mid rise Straight Fit Shorts
£30.00
ONSTEL Regular Fit Shorts
£28.00
ONSDEAN-MIKE Regular Fit Cargo Shorts
£45.00
ONSTEL Mid waist Regular Fit Shorts
£30.00
ONSPLY Mid waist Slim Fit Shorts
£38.00
ONSTED Swim Shorts
£16.00
ONSPLY Regular Fit Shorts
£30.00
ONSMARK Regular Fit Shorts
£30.00
ONSPLY Mid waist Regular Fit Shorts
£24.00
ONSTED Swim Shorts
£18.00
ONSKIAN Mid waist Regular Fit Shorts
£28.00
ONSTEL Regular Fit Shorts
£45.00
2 for £ 49
ONSKAL Slim Fit Shorts
£26.00
ONSTEL Mid waist Regular Fit Shorts
£30.00
ONSFADE Mid waist Loose Fit Shorts
£30.00
ONSTEL Mid waist Regular Fit Shorts
£30.00
ONSLINUS Mid waist Tapered Fit Shorts
£30.00
£18.00
40%
ONSLINUS Mid rise Loose Fit Shorts
£26.00
£18.20
30%
ONSCAM Regular Fit Shorts
£24.00
£16.80
30%
ONSAVI Shorts
£32.00
£19.20
40%
ONSMARK Regular Fit Shorts
£30.00
£24.00
20%
ONSLINUS Loose Fit Shorts
£32.00
£22.40
30%
ONSPLY Mid waist Slim Fit Shorts
£24.00
£16.80
30%
1
2
3
Home
Menu
Wishlist
Account
Basket